Setting up FitBit auto-syncing.
We do see the 2 requests in the IIS logs, but the endpoint is still not being verified. We use a proxy server and redirect to the server we want, which is not externally accessible.
Both are GET request and one is a 204 and the other is a 404. The verification code for the 204 matches up with what is on the FitBit site.
